Transaction 30ae4890394c6ad04a6f4a62bb4824ace891e45f6de8aab09bb01f042d99a5a1
1 Input
1 Output
-
30ae4890394c6ad04a6f4a62bb4824ace891e45f6de8aab09bb01f042d99a5a1:0
- value
- 44837
- script pubkey
- OP_0 OP_PUSHBYTES_20 e425aac5893efe4772fdde20338d678631a58f9a
- address
- bc1qusj643vf8mlywuhamcsr8rt8scc6tru6qpx0pr